Vaibhav Sooryavanshi, a 15-year-old cricket prodigy, is garnering attention for his extraordinary talent, drawing comparisons to cricket legends such as Sachin Tendulkar and Virat Kohli. Madan Lal, a former cricketer and 1983 World Cup winner, praised Sooryavanshi's 'god gifted talent and mindset' in an interview, urging the national team to consider him soon. Sooryavanshi excelled in the recent IPL 2026, where he was the most valuable player with 776 runs from 16 innings, achieving an impressive average of 48.50 and a strike rate of 237.30. He also set a new record for the most sixes in a season, surpassing Chris Gayle's previous record with 72 sixes. Lal emphasized that while Sooryavanshi's talent is undeniable, he must establish himself in Test cricket to be considered among the greats. He also expressed concerns that Sooryavanshi's emergence might lead to the sidelining of established players, indicating the need for careful team management as the young player develops.
